I tend to nerd out about film music, so this one’s fun: the words to 'Love Is an Open Door' were penned by Kristen Anderson-Lopez and Robert Lopez. They wrote the songs for 'Frozen' as a team — crafting lyrics and tunes that advance character and plot, not just catchy choruses. That particular song works brilliantly because the lyrics sound sincere at first, then reveal layers once you know the twist; that’s smart musical storytelling. Kristen Bell and Santino Fontana bring it to life on screen, but credit for the clever phrasing and the way the couple’s lines play off each other goes to the Lopezes. If you’re dissecting how songs function in animation, their work on 'Frozen' is a really rewarding case study — from lyrical economy to melodic motifs that tie into the characters’ arcs, there’s a lot to unpack.

I've dug into this one a bunch because I used to karaoke 'Love Is an Open Door' with friends in different languages — so yes, there are official translated versions. Disney localized 'Frozen' into many languages for theatrical release, streaming, and soundtrack albums, and the duet 'Love Is an Open Door' appears in those dubs. That means you'll find officially performed and published lyric versions in languages like Spanish (both Castilian and Latin American in some markets), French, German, Italian, Portuguese (Brazil), Japanese, Korean, Mandarin, and more. In practice, those translations are usually lyrical adaptations rather than literal line-for-line translations. Local lyricists rewrite the words to fit the melody, rhyme, and cultural rhythm, so the meaning can shift to keep the song singable. If you want to track them down, check Disney's official channels: the regional Disney Music pages, the soundtrack listings on Spotify/iTunes for your country, or the audio/subtitle options on Disney+. Official YouTube uploads sometimes include international versions too. Also look at album credits — the translator/lyricist name is often listed, which helps confirm it's an authorized translation. Are Frozen Love Is An Open Door Lyrics Different In Translations?

4 Answers2025-08-29 09:19:30
I still get the chills when that duet kicks in, and one thing I always notice is how translations of 'Love is an Open Door' can feel delightfully different from the English original. When songs get localized, translators juggle rhyme, rhythm, and the need to match sung syllables to the melody and lip movements. That means literal meaning often takes a back seat. In some languages the lines are almost a direct equivalent, but in many others a phrase will be altered so it fits the music or lands as a joke where the original pun wouldn’t work. Subtitles tend to be more literal because they’re meant to convey meaning quickly, while dubbed singing must be singable and sometimes even changes a line’s nuance to preserve rhyme or comedic timing.
